Why plastic fences fall short below more than elsewhere

Vinyl is resilient, but it has weak points that local conditions exploit.

The wind is the very first wrongdoer. The stress from a 40 mile-per-hour gust on a six-foot personal privacy panel is seriously, and the network messages that hold the panel can bend or fracture if the rails are not properly secured. Fencings along wide streets like Edinger or near open lots often tend to see even more panel blowouts because there is less to slow the wind. The Santa Ana winds that sweep below the canyons each autumn dry out the air and make plastic more brittle temporarily, after that struck it with a push.

UV exposure is the 2nd. South and west dealing with runs leaning vinyl fence fade much faster, obtain hairline cracks at tension factors, and are much more susceptible to chalking. White plastic does best, darker colors soak up more warmth and show distortion around screws or brackets. The UV index below regularly hits 8 to 10 in summer, which accelerates oxidation on affordable formulas that lack sufficient titanium dioxide.

Moisture plays a quieter role. Irrigation overspray from pop-up lawn sprinklers or drip lines that leak along the fencing line can blemish posts with tough water finding, invite algae, and saturate the soil around footings. Vinyl itself does not rot, yet the concrete that anchors your articles can loosen up as damp dirt expands and dries. In backyards with heavy clay or backfill, you see leaning messages and heaving panels after a damp winter.

Then there is equipment. Gates make up a big section of vinyl fence repair contacts Santa Ana. The messages are hollow and require interior support, normally a light weight aluminum or steel insert, to hold hinge lag screws. When the home builder misses that, an entrance that swings loads of times a day will pull the fasteners loose in 2 to 3 years. Add a child holding on it, or a gardener that leans a blower on it, and the droop shows up fast.

The most typical vinyl fence repairs and just how they are fixed

Cracked pickets happen where a weed leaner strikes the lower side or where a sphere strikes the midspan. The appropriate repair is to unlock the top rail, slide out the split picket, and slide in a matching substitute. On older fences with weak rails, the technology might have to reduce and replace a section of rail also. Quick caulking is a bandage at best, and it will yellow.

Panel blowouts are normal after a gusty night. You will see the tongue-and-groove pickets splayed, the lower rail bowed, or one end of the panel popped out of the blog post. The repair work is to re-seat the panel, usually replacing damaged U-channels, bottom rail clips, or finish caps. If the article has fractured at the routed holes, it might require a sleeve or full substitute with brand-new concrete. When panels pop multiple times along the same run, the fix often consists of adding light weight aluminum rail support to reduce flex.

Leaning posts indicate a footing issue. In many tract homes, plastic messages were set in 8 to 10 inches of concrete since the installer was racing the clock. In wind corridors, a six-foot fence needs bigger, deeper grounds, frequently 12 inches large and 24 inches deep, with compacted base. A proper repair service includes very carefully removing the message, getting rid of loosened concrete, re-drilling to deepness, and resetting with fresh concrete that crowns above quality so water sheds.

Gate sag and latch misalignment can be repaired without reconstructing the entire gate. The tech checks for a metal insert in the joint article, replaces removed lag screws with through-bolts where possible, and mounts a flexible joint set that permits fine tuning. An angled support inside the gate frame may be added to transfer weight to the hinge side. If the gate structure itself is racked, a reconstruct with reinforced rails is the honest call.

Scuffs, spots, and chalking call for cleaning, not paint. A soft brush, a bucket of warm water with a little dish soap, and a magic eraser manage most grime. For algae or mildew along dubious runs, a watered down oxygen bleach functions. Prevent acetone or extreme solvents, which can haze the surface. For iron stains from lawn sprinkler water, a gentle oxalic acid cleaner, used sparingly, lifts the orange without etching.

Cost, timelines, and what drives both

Most single-issue vinyl fence repair calls, like a broken picket or a stood out panel, autumn in the 200 to 450 dollar range in Santa Ana when parts are conveniently available and accessibility is clear. Gate rehanging with new hinges and lock runs 300 to 600 depending upon whether the joint message requires support. Leaning article resets usually begin around 350 for one post and range up by 200 to 300 for each additional post because much of the time is in setup and concrete work.

Complex wind damages with multiple messages and several panels can get to 1,200 to 2,500, especially if matching components need to be unique gotten. Lead time on uncommon accounts varies from 2 days to 2 weeks. After a significant wind event, good firms triage calls, stabilize the most awful failings initially, then circle back to complete visual repairs. That line up can add a day or two.

Two aspects turn cost more than any type of others. Gain access to is big. If the technology can wheel a mixer or generate concrete near to the work, labor stays low. If they need to hand-carry with a tight side backyard, the job takes longer. The 2nd is what lies under your fencing line. Tree origins, old footings, or hidden irrigation lines slow excavation and raise threat. A pro will certainly penetrate very first and established expectations.

Repair or replace, and just how to determine with a clear head

Vinyl fencing repair work makes sense if the troubles are local et cetera of the fence is sound. Two or three busted pickets, one leaning article, or a grouchy gateway do not justify a full replacement. When damages extends throughout futures, or when the vinyl itself is fragile throughout, substitute may be smarter.

Age is a hint, not a verdict. I have actually seen 18-year-old fencings that clean up fresh because they were installed with appropriate reinforcements and avoided overspray. I have likewise removed seven-year-old panels that ruined like glass because a deal brand was made use of. Evaluate a concealed area with modest pressure. If a level screwdriver pushed gently right into a surface produces a spider crack, the vinyl has actually shed a lot of plasticizers and is near completion of its helpful life.

Budget issues, but so does disturbance. Full substitute changes a backyard for a week, with demolition, transporting, and permits if you alter anything about height or line. When eviction is the only problem

Gates fail in a different way from panels. The weight focuses at the hinge blog post and intends to draw it out of plumb. Start there. Enhance the blog post inside, upgrade the joint readied to a flexible style with stainless pins, and set the gate so the lock meets cleanly without lift. If children or pet dogs push hard on the latch, a striker with a bigger catch zone offers you resistance. Self-closing hinges, needed around swimming pools, require great tuning to fulfill code and stay clear of slamming. A little persistence here settles with quiet procedure for years.

Emergency stablizing after a wind event

When a panel blows out or a post leans dangerously, a couple of gauged activities will certainly stop further damages while you wait on help.

  • Turn off sprinklers that soak the area near the failure so the ground does not soften more.
  • Use a couple of timber risks and a strap to support a leaning message back towards plumb, positioning the risks in undisturbed soil.
  • Pick up and stack loosened pickets and caps in the shade to avoid bending in straight sun.
  • If a gate will certainly not lock, get rid of the lock demonstrator temporarily and protect eviction gathered a rope to a secure anchor.
  • Keep animals and kids away from the location, especially from panels that are partly unseated and can fall.

These are substitutes, not repairs. They purchase time and restriction security damage while you wait on a crew.

Maintenance that prolongs the life of your repaired fence

Vinyl is reduced upkeep, but not no upkeep. Twice a year, offer the fence a quick wash. A tube, a soft brush, and mild soap keep surface gunk from embedding. Consider including splash guards to irrigation heads that are also close to the fencing, or angle them somewhat. Cut vines early before they root right into networks. Leave a one-inch space at the bottom rail when you add compost so the fence does not touch continuously moist soil.

If you see small concerns, act early. A leading rail that hums in the wind today is a blown panel next month. A latch that captures just if you raise the gate is a loose hinge in the making. The repair after damages prices greater than a tune up ahead of time.

Frequently Ask Questions about Vinyl Fence Repair


How to fix a vinyl fence piece?

To fix a vinyl fence piece, first identify the damaged section. Small cracks or holes can be repaired using vinyl repair kits or epoxy. For broken panels, replacement pieces may be necessary, which often snap into the existing posts. Ensure the fence is clean and dry before applying repair materials.

What's the life expectancy of a vinyl fence?

Vinyl fences typically last 20 to 30 years with proper maintenance. Life expectancy depends on climate, quality of materials, and exposure to sunlight. Regular cleaning and avoiding physical damage can extend lifespan. Higher-quality vinyl products generally last longer than budget options.

Are vinyl fences hard to repair?

Vinyl fences are relatively easy to repair for minor cracks or scratches using repair kits or adhesives. Major damage, such as broken panels or posts, usually requires replacement pieces. Repairs are simpler than with wood since vinyl does not rot or require painting. Some repairs may require disassembly of adjacent panels.

What is the average price of a vinyl fence?

The average cost of a vinyl fence ranges from $20 to $40 per linear foot, depending on height, style, and quality. Installation costs vary and can increase the overall expense. Custom designs or high-end materials may cost more. Vinyl fencing is typically more expensive upfront than wood but requires less maintenance over time.

Can you repair a hole in vinyl?

Yes, small holes in vinyl can be repaired using vinyl patch kits, epoxy, or adhesive. The area should be cleaned and dried before applying the repair material. For larger holes, replacement panels may be more effective. Sanding or smoothing may be necessary to match the surface texture.

Can I use PVC glue on a vinyl fence?

PVC glue is not recommended for all vinyl fences because vinyl and PVC may have different chemical compositions. Using the correct vinyl adhesive or epoxy designed for outdoor vinyl is safer. Always check the manufacturer’s recommendations. Using incompatible glue can weaken the bond and cause failure.

What holds a vinyl fence up?

Vinyl fences are supported by posts, which are usually anchored in concrete for stability. Panels attach to these posts using brackets or rails. Proper installation and spacing are key for structural integrity. The posts bear most of the wind and weight stress on the fence.

What are the downsides of vinyl fencing?

Downsides of vinyl fencing include higher upfront cost compared to wood, potential discoloration from prolonged sun exposure, and brittleness in extreme cold. Repairs can be tricky if panels are severely damaged. Vinyl fences can also warp or crack under heavy impact. Some homeowners may prefer the natural aesthetic of wood.

What lasts longer, a wood fence or a vinyl fence?

Vinyl fences generally last longer than wood fences, often 20–30 years versus 10–15 years for wood. Vinyl is resistant to rot, insect damage, and weathering. Wood may require staining or sealing to extend its life. Properly maintained wood can approach vinyl’s lifespan but usually requires more ongoing maintenance.

Is it possible to fix a scratched vinyl?

Yes, minor scratches on vinyl can be repaired using a vinyl repair kit, heat, or a rubbing compound designed for plastics. Deep scratches may require replacement of the affected panel. Cleaning the area first ensures better adhesion or smoothing. Light scratches may also fade over time with sun exposure.

Will vinegar ruin a vinyl fence?

Vinegar is generally safe for cleaning vinyl fences in diluted form, but undiluted vinegar or frequent use can dull the surface. Always rinse the fence thoroughly after cleaning. Mild soap and water are typically safer for regular maintenance. Avoid abrasive scrubbing that can damage the finish.

What is the lifespan of a vinyl fence?

The lifespan of a vinyl fence is typically 20–30 years, depending on material quality and maintenance. Exposure to extreme sunlight or harsh weather can reduce longevity. Regular cleaning and avoiding physical damage can extend its usable life. Higher-grade vinyl tends to last longer than cheaper alternatives.
